Identity verification emerges as the cornerstone of establishing unwavering trust between users and businesses across China's rapidly evolving digital landscape, where traditional in-person interactions are increasingly replaced by sophisticated online encounters. This critical process serves as the fundamental barrier against fraudulent activities, identity theft, and unauthorized access to sensitive services that form the backbone of China's digital economy. Chinese banks leverage sophisticated identity verification systems to comply with Know Your Customer regulations mandated by the People's Bank of China and other regulatory bodies, while simultaneously reducing fraud rates that could otherwise undermine consumer confidence in digital banking services. Electronic commerce platforms across China implement comprehensive identity verification protocols to prevent the creation of fake accounts and ensure that all transactions occur between legitimate parties, fostering a marketplace environment where consumers can shop with confidence. Chinese companies are embedding identity verification checks directly into customer workflows, creating streamlined processes that minimize friction while maximizing security effectiveness, ensuring that users can access services quickly without compromising verification quality. Real-time verification capabilities have been enhanced through strategic integrations with artificial intelligence systems, advanced camera technologies, and sophisticated document scanning solutions that can instantly analyze and authenticate identity documents with remarkable accuracy. China's identity verification landscape features sophisticated technologies that utilize the country's national identification documents, including the Resident Identity Card system, where users position their official identity cards in front of cameras for automated verification processes. These advanced optical recognition systems can instantly read the embedded security features, verify document authenticity, and cross-reference the information against government databases to ensure complete accuracy.

China is implementing a new Anti-Money Laundering Law in 2025 that will revolutionize identity verification processes, requiring financial and tech companies to adopt more sophisticated AI-based compliance systems. Companies operating within China's market are demonstrating increased focus on how user data is collected, stored, and utilized throughout the verification process, recognizing that privacy protection has become a critical competitive differentiator and regulatory requirement. The growing demand for transparency and explicit consent in identity verification processes reflects Chinese consumers' increasing awareness of data privacy rights and their expectations for responsible data handling practices. Ethical considerations surrounding the use of biometric data and artificial intelligence technologies are becoming integral components of solution development, with companies investing heavily in technologies that balance security effectiveness with privacy protection and user rights. In March 2025, China's Cyberspace Administration introduced regulations mandating that individuals should not be compelled to use facial recognition for identity verification. Chinese users increasingly expect seamless verification experiences that allow them to authenticate themselves across multiple devices and platforms without repeatedly completing lengthy verification procedures, driving demand for unified identity solutions that can maintain verification status across diverse digital touchpoints. On July 15, 2025, measures implementing China's national internet identity authentication services take effect, establishing a centralized platform for real name verification of internet users, where the online ID card allows users to obtain a unique digital ID number and certificate via the National Online Identity Authentication app. Identity verification systems in China are being closely integrated with comprehensive cybersecurity frameworks that include multi factor authentication, advanced encryption protocols, and sophisticated access control mechanisms, creating layered security architectures that protect against multiple types of threats.

In China, the identity verification market is overwhelmingly shaped by digital verification solutions, with services playing a supplemental yet important role. Homegrown high-tech providers such as Sense Time, Megvii, Yitu, and Huawei have rapidly advanced facial recognition, document scanning, and AI-powered fraud detection systems, which businesses across sectors from fintech and e-commerce to public transit and urban services have embraced for their efficiency and real time capabilities. These platforms form the backbone of digital onboarding, enabling seamless verification within apps, kiosks, and smart city infrastructures all designed to meet rigorous regulatory and performance standards. A pivotal leap forward has been the development and rollout of China RealDID, the country's block chain based decentralized identity system built atop the national Block chain-based Service Network (BSN). It allows users to authenticate their identity using cryptographic key pairs instead of exposing personal data, effectively decoupling actual identities from transactions while ensuring compliance with real name requirements. RealDID introduces anonymity at the front desk and real name at the backend, allowing secure access across services without compromising privacy. While these solutions dominate, service-based verification including manual document review, video identification, or in person checks remains relevant for high touch sectors and underserved populations. Businesses conducting complex financial transactions or serving remote communities often resort to human-assisted verification as a failsafe. China’s leading organizations increasingly adopt a hybrid model, using automated solutions for broad coverage and services for edge cases. Digital infrastructure forms the core, while service options backstop situations where technology faces limitations.

In China, identity verification is significantly driven by biometric methods, which have become the default mode of authentication across most digital and physical environments. Technologies such as facial recognition, fingerprint scanning, palm-vein mapping, and voice authentication are deeply embedded in everyday services. Whether accessing banking apps, entering metro stations, checking into smart offices, or making purchases through platforms like Alipay and WeChat Pay, biometric verification is now routine. Chinese tech companies like sense Time, Megvii, and Yitu have led the innovation curve by developing AI-powered biometric systems that are highly accurate and scalable. These technologies are not limited to private enterprises they are actively utilized in state-run systems such as the Skynet surveillance network, which integrates facial recognition with CCTV infrastructure to monitor and authenticate citizens in real time. Adding to this widespread adoption is RealDID, a state backed decentralized digital identity platform that allows citizens to authenticate themselves through cryptographic methods. While RealDID supports privacy by design, it still relies on biometric data at the point of user enrollment, further cementing biometrics as the core of China’s identity infrastructure. The platform enables secure access to a wide range of public and private services, reinforcing real-name policies while enhancing user privacy. Despite biometrics dominating the identity landscape, non-biometric methods continue to play a crucial role, particularly in scenarios where digital or biometric tools are less viable. Physical ID cards, password entry, and manual document checks are commonly used in rural areas, with elderly populations, or in legal and administrative settings where digital literacy may be lower. These traditional methods are also necessary when users opt out of facial recognition, especially following regulatory guidelines that prohibit mandatory biometric use.

Large enterprises, such as national banks, telecom giants, insurance providers, tech platforms like Ant Group, and various government ministries, are at the forefront of deploying highly customized, full-scale biometric identity systems. These organizations operate across critical sectors including finance, healthcare, transportation, and e-governance, where the need for accuracy, security, and compliance is non-negotiable. Leveraging advanced platforms like RealDID, backed by institutions such as CTID short for China Telecom’s Identity service, these enterprises ensure end-to-end real-name verification while maintaining control over data sovereignty and regulatory alignment. Their systems often integrate multiple biometric methods like facial recognition, fingerprint scans, and voice ID while ensuring seamless user experiences across mobile apps, kiosks, and in-person touchpoints. Their adoption of hybrid infrastructure on-premises for sensitive data, and cloud for scalability further showcases their commitment to performance and control. SMEs, on the other hand, approach identity verification from a more agile and cost-effective standpoint. These businesses ranging from local e-commerce vendors to logistics firms and fintech startups lean on cloud-based identity-as-a-service platforms. Many integrate plug-and-play APIs or tools offered by major platforms like WeChat or Alipay, embedding biometric verification into their apps or mini-programs without the need for heavy infrastructure investments.

In China, the choice between on-premises and cloud-based deployment models for identity verification is heavily shaped by factors such as regulatory compliance, data security mandates, and the technical maturity of the implementing organization. These deployment preferences vary widely across industries, with each approach offering distinct advantages in different operational contexts. On-premises deployment remains the preferred model for highly regulated sectors, including state owned banks, legal authorities, public sector departments, and major telecom or utility providers. These organizations prioritize strict control over user data, particularly in light of China's data sovereignty laws and the Cybersecurity Law, which mandate that sensitive personal and national data be processed and stored within domestic boundaries. On-premises systems allow for robust, customizable security architectures, deeper integration with existing IT ecosystems, and enhanced auditing capabilities. Solutions like China Telecom Identity Service and other government-aligned platforms are commonly deployed on premises to ensure both operational sovereignty and national compliance. Cloud-based deployment has gained considerable traction among fast-scaling sectors such as fintech, e-commerce, ride hailing, logistics, and small-to-medium enterprises. Cloud solutions offer quick deployment, lower upfront costs, and elastic scalability, which aligns with the innovation cycles of startups and digital first businesses. Identity verification solutions hosted in the cloud often integrate facial recognition, document scanning, and RealDID-based identity frameworks through API-driven services. To stay compliant with Chinese laws, these cloud solutions are typically hosted on domestic cloud infrastructure, striking a balance between agility and legal conformity. Hybrid deployment models have emerged as a middle path. In this setup, the identity capture process like facial scans or document uploads occurs via the cloud, while sensitive data and core decision making remain on secure local servers. RealDID exemplifies this hybrid model, offering front end anonymity paired with back-end real-name verification, ensuring both flexibility and accountability.
